We have a little Klingon girl
So Friday night "Momma" goes upstairs to fix dinner (Chinese take out) and I turn around to put another log on the fire when we hear a THUD!

I turn around and see Josie face down by the coffe table with her toys on it. Momma comes rushing hysterically down the stairs as I grab Josie who is beet red and about to let out a cry the whole neighborhood can hear. She is bleeding from the nose and a little bit from the mouth. I immediately begin barking out "Calm down! Call the Doctor!" Doctor is off for the weekend so we get the oncall system. We decide to take Josie to the Emergency Room.

We only spent a total of 2 hours in the ER. They took us into triage right away. No broken bone, no broke cartilege, no head injury (a 6 foot fall onto a surface is usually needed for that :shrug: ) everything is just fine.

BUT the bridge of her nose was swollen (attempts at ice were denied) and very broad. She has many similarities to the Klingon type.

She is okay.
